WebSep 20, 2024 · Crypto staking is the process of locking up crypto holdings in order to obtain rewards or earn interest. Cryptocurrencies are built with blockchain technology, in which crypto transactions are verified, and the resulting data is stored on the blockchain. WebMar 13, 2024 · Stake: Financial returns Investors include both shareholders and debtholders. Shareholders invest capital in the business and expect to earn a certain rate of return on that invested capital. Investors are commonly concerned with the concept of shareholder value. WebWhat is an equity stake? An equity stake is the percentage of a business owned by the holder of some number of shares of stock in that company.
